What to Look For in a Marketing Automation Platform
Breadth vs depth: All-in-one platforms (HubSpot, ActiveCampaign) cover more channels but go less deep in each. Specialised platforms (Klaviyo for ecommerce, beehiiv for newsletters) go deeper in one domain. Match to your primary channel.
AI quality matters now: The gap between platforms that use AI as a gimmick and those where AI genuinely improves outcomes is large. Look for AI that personalises send times, subject lines, and content at the individual level — not just at the segment level.
Integration with your stack: A platform that does not connect to your CRM, attribution tool, and data warehouse becomes a silo. Connectivity is as important as features.
Pricing at your growth stage: The cheapest option today often becomes the most expensive at scale. Calculate the cost at 5x your current contact list before committing.

1. HubSpot Marketing Hub
→ hubspot.com | Free / $800 / $3,600 per month
Best for: Growth-stage companies who want all-in-one marketing, sales, and service
HubSpot is the most complete marketing platform available — email, landing pages, forms, SEO, social, ads, CRM, and reporting in one place. The free CRM genuinely is free and powerful enough for early-stage companies. The Marketing Hub adds automation, A/B testing, and AI-powered tools. The AI features in 2026 include AI email generation, content assistant, and ChatSpot (a GPT-powered interface for your HubSpot data).
Key features:
- All-in-one: email, landing pages, forms, social, CRM
- Marketing automation workflows
- AI content assistant (email, landing pages, blogs)
- SEO tools and content strategy
- ABM (account-based marketing) tools
Pricing:
| Plan | Price | Contacts |
|---|---|---|
| Free CRM | $0 | Unlimited |
| Starter | $20/mo | 1,000 marketing contacts |
| Professional | $800/mo | 2,000 contacts |
| Enterprise | $3,600/mo | 10,000 contacts |
Honest limitation: HubSpot Professional and Enterprise are expensive for what they are. At $800/mo for 2,000 contacts, the cost per contact is high. Companies that need just email automation are better served by ActiveCampaign or Klaviyo at lower price points.
G2 Rating: 4.4/5 (12,000+ reviews)
2. ActiveCampaign
→ activecampaign.com | From $15/month
Best for: Mid-market companies who want powerful automation without HubSpot's price
ActiveCampaign is the email marketing and automation platform most often compared to HubSpot — but at a significantly lower price point. Its automation builder is one of the most powerful in the market: complex conditional logic, split testing within automations, and deep CRM integration. The AI features (predictive sending, win probability scoring) are among the better implementations of AI in email marketing.
Key features:
- Visual automation builder with complex conditional logic
- Predictive email send time optimisation
- Built-in CRM with deal pipeline
- Site tracking (behaviour-triggered automations)
- SMS and multichannel messaging
Pricing:
| Plan | Price | Contacts |
|---|---|---|
| Starter | $15/mo | 1,000 |
| Plus | $49/mo | 1,000 |
| Professional | $79/mo | 1,000 |
| Enterprise | Custom | Custom |
When to choose over HubSpot: You need more automation sophistication at lower cost. You want to pay for email automation without paying for HubSpot's full platform.
G2 Rating: 4.5/5 (13,000+ reviews)
3. Klaviyo
→ klaviyo.com | Free / From $45/month
Best for: Ecommerce brands on Shopify, WooCommerce, or BigCommerce
Klaviyo is the dominant email and SMS platform for ecommerce. Its integration with Shopify is deeper than any competitor — every browse, cart, purchase, and return event flows into Klaviyo automatically. The segmentation is real-time and powerful: target customers who viewed a specific product in the last 7 days, spent over $200 in the last 90 days, and live in a specific postal code. The AI features include predictive CLV, next-order date forecasting, and churn risk scoring.
Key features:
- Real-time Shopify/WooCommerce event sync
- Predictive customer lifetime value
- Abandoned cart, browse abandonment, win-back flows
- SMS and push notification
- A/B testing at scale
Pricing:
| Plan | Price | Contacts |
|---|---|---|
| Free | $0 | 500 contacts, 500 emails/month |
| $45/mo | 1,001–1,500 contacts | |
| Email + SMS | $60/mo | 1,001–1,500 contacts |
Honest limitation: Strong for ecommerce, weaker for B2B or SaaS use cases without an ecommerce integration.
G2 Rating: 4.6/5 (2,200+ reviews)

5. Brevo (formerly Sendinblue)
→ brevo.com | Free / $25 / $65 per month
Best for: Multichannel marketing on a budget — email, SMS, WhatsApp, push
Brevo's pricing model (charged by email volume, not by contact count) makes it unusually cost-effective at large list sizes. A 100,000-contact list costs the same as a 1,000-contact list — you pay for sends, not for storage. Strong for transactional email, marketing automation, and SMS combined. The WhatsApp business messaging integration is a differentiator for non-US markets.
Key features:
- Email, SMS, WhatsApp, push in one platform
- Contact-count-free pricing model
- Transactional email API
- Marketing automation workflows
- Live chat and landing pages
Pricing:
| Plan | Price | Emails/Month |
|---|---|---|
| Free | $0 | 300/day, unlimited contacts |
| Starter | $25/mo | 20,000 |
| Business | $65/mo | 20,000+ unlimited sends |
6. Customer.io
→ customer.io | From $100/month
Best for: SaaS companies with data-rich customer journeys
Customer.io is the email and lifecycle automation platform built for SaaS businesses with complex data events. You pipe any customer event — login, feature use, trial start, payment failure — and build automations triggered by that real behaviour. Far more flexible than Mailchimp or HubSpot for data-event-driven communication. The visual journey builder handles conditional logic that simpler tools cannot.
Key features:
- Event-triggered automations from custom data
- Liquid templating for deep personalisation
- Email, SMS, push, in-app messages, webhooks
- Data pipeline integration (Segment, Snowflake)
- A/B testing and holdout groups
Pricing:
| Plan | Price | Profiles |
|---|---|---|
| Essentials | $100/mo | 5,000 |
| Premium | $1,000/mo | 15,000 |
| Enterprise | Custom | Custom |

12. Klaviyo vs Omnisend (Ecommerce Comparison)
For ecommerce brands specifically, Omnisend is the strongest alternative to Klaviyo:
| Feature | Klaviyo | Omnisend |
|---|---|---|
| Price (1,000 contacts) | $45/mo | $16/mo |
| Shopify integration | ✓✓ Best | ✓ Strong |
| SMS | ✓ | ✓ |
| Push notifications | Limited | ✓ |
| Automations | ✓✓ | ✓ |
| AI features | Predictive CLV | Send time optimisation |
Klaviyo is the more powerful and data-rich platform. Omnisend is the better value for smaller ecommerce brands and includes push notifications that Klaviyo lacks.

How to Choose: Marketing Automation Decision Framework
By company type
Early-stage startup (< $1M ARR): Start with Mailchimp (email) + a CRM free tier (HubSpot or Attio) + Zapier for connections. Keep it simple — the platform is not the constraint at this stage, the strategy is.
Growth-stage SaaS ($1M–$10M ARR): Customer.io or Loops for product emails, HubSpot for marketing + CRM, Instantly for outbound. This covers most of the automation surface area.
Ecommerce brand (any size): Klaviyo is the clear choice. If cost is a constraint, Omnisend or Drip. Supplement with a dedicated attribution tool once ad spend exceeds $10K/month.
Enterprise B2B: Marketo or HubSpot Enterprise for automation, Salesforce for CRM, dedicated ABM platform (Demandbase, 6sense) if running account-based programmes.
Content creator / newsletter: beehiiv — purpose-built, best economics, best growth tools.

What is the difference between marketing automation and email marketing? Email marketing sends emails. Marketing automation sequences communications across email, SMS, push, and in-app messages based on customer behaviour — triggered by actions like signing up, making a purchase, or abandoning a cart. All marketing automation platforms include email; most email marketing tools do not include full automation.
